Healthcare Compliance Attorney / Consultant: Turnkey Clinic Setup & Policy Development

Remote Full-time
Job Description: We are seeking a reliable and experienced Healthcare Compliance Attorney or Legal Consultant to develop a comprehensive, turnkey compliance and operational infrastructure for our practice. The ideal partner will have a deep understanding of federal and state-specific healthcare regulations and a proven track record of building "ready-to-use" policy binders for medical clinics. Scope of Work: We require the development and delivery of the following four pillars: Comprehensive Compliance Plan: A formal, written plan covering federal and state-specific mandates, including HIPAA, OSHA, and Stark/Anti-Kickback (where applicable). Virtual Binder of Policies & Patient Forms: A complete digital repository in editable formats (Word/PDF) including: Patient Forms: Intake, Medical History, Consent for Treatment, and Financial Responsibility. Clinic Policies: Code of Conduct, Social Media Policy, and Privacy Practices. Mandated & Best Practice Policies: Drafting of all policies required by law, as well as operational "best practice" guidelines to mitigate long-term liability. Employee Training: A structured training module or protocol for new and existing staff to ensure full implementation of the compliance plan. Project Timeline: These items must be finalized and ready for implementation by Mid-February. Candidate Qualifications: Proven experience in US Healthcare Regulatory Law. Ability to provide editable templates tailored to our specific state [Insert State]. Experience in creating training materials for clinical staff. Strong preference for candidates who offer flat-fee packages or structured "compliance-in-a-box" solutions. Application Requirements: Please submit your proposal including: A brief overview of your experience in the healthcare sector. A preliminary quote or fee structure (Flat-fee preferred; please specify if you offer a subscription-based "compliance membership").
